Did Skechers get sued for shape-ups?

Did Skechers get sued for shape-ups?

Skechers Skechers must pay $40 million to people who bought its “toning” shoes, a federal judge has ruled. The settlement covers more than 520,000 claims that the health benefits of some of the company’s shoes, which include the “Shape-Ups” endorsed by Kim Kardashian, were falsely advertised, according to the AP.

What is the deal with Skechers?

The Federal Trade Commission announced that Skechers USA, Inc. has agreed to pay $40 million to settle charges that the company deceived consumers by making unfounded claims that Shape-ups would help people lose weight, and strengthen and tone their buttocks, legs and abdominal muscles.

Why is a woman suing skecher Shape ups?

Woman sues Skechers over Shape-ups shoes. Feb. 16, 2011 — — A new lawsuit alleges that Skecher’s Shape-up shoes can cause serious injuries. An Ohio woman is suing the company after developing stress fractures in both hips — which she blames on the shoes. Skecher’s Shape-ups have a distinctive round sole.

What did the FTC say about Skechers Shape ups?

The FTC alleges that Skechers made unsupported claims that Shape-ups would provide more weight loss, and more muscle toning and strengthening than regular fitness shoes.

Who is the actress in the Skechers Shape ups commercial?

Shape-ups ads featuring celebrities including Kim Kardashian and Brooke Burke. Airing during the 2011 Super Bowl, the Kardashian ad showed her dumping her personal trainer for a pair of Shape-ups. The Burke ad told consumers that the newest way to burn calories and tone and strengthen muscles was to tie their Shape-ups shoe laces.

How does a Skechers Shape ups shoe work?

Skechers and its critics do agree on one thing: Shape-ups shoes change the way you walk. A Skechers training video advises wearers to “step forward with the middle section of your heel hitting the ground first. Roll forward onto the ball of your foot and push off with your toes.”
